SCOPE

Location

CEA Project Logistics were employed to receive 83 pieces of break bulk cargo from Khao Hin Son, Thailand. The cargo would be consolidated at the CEA cargo consolidation facility in Laem Chabang and preapred for load out at Laem Chabang Port. The cargo consisted of oil refinery parts bound for Mongla, Bangladesh.

Laem Chabang, Thailand Duration 5 Days

CEA PROVIDED

• Man power • Cranes, reach stacker, forklifts • Cargo consolidation lay down area • Lifting equipment as neccessary • Trucks, trailers, specialised trailers • Transportation from Laem Chabang - LRT • Supervise load out operation • Port communication, wharfage and handling
